Zhang Xiang Qian was born in 1967 in rural Lujiang County, Anhui Province, China. With only a junior high school education, he claims to have visited an advanced alien planet in 1985 at the age of 19. For nearly four decades, he has dedicated himself to promoting what he calls 'artificial field scanning technology' and a unified field theory acquired during this encounter. Despite facing skepticism and financial hardship, Zhang continues to share his theories through various platforms while working as a welder and bicycle repairman in his hometown.
